The ultimate validation of this genre came with mainstream digital adaptations. Major Indian OTT (Over-The-Top) streaming platforms have produced biographical series and fictionalized anthologies based on the life and stories of Mastram. These shows trade the old, cheap paperbacks for high-production-value visual storytelling, introducing the nostalgic charm of 1980s and 90s pulp fiction to Gen Z and millennial audiences. The lasting appeal of Mastram and "Bibi" romantic fiction lies in its raw, unpretentious exploration of human desire within a highly conservative society. While mainstream cinema and literature often polished romance into idealized, sanitized versions, pulp fiction remained raw, relatable, and unapologetically focused on the unspoken fantasies of the common man and woman. It provides an escapist outlet where traditional boundaries are temporarily pushed aside in the name of passion and storytelling. Unlike mainstream romance novels that follow traditional courtship, Mastram-style fiction frequently explores suppressed emotions, unfulfilled desires, and the psychological impact of strict social boundaries. The tension between societal duty and personal passion forms the core dramatic engine of every plot.
